COVID cases rising in 25 states, but nationwide activity 'low': CDC

https://thehill.com/policy/5402022-covid-cases-rising-in-25-states-but-nationwide-activity-low-cdc/

Infections of COVID-19 are growing or likely growing in half of the U.S. as of early July,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) estimates.

Modeling from the agency shows the West Coast, Southeast and South are the primary region for increased cases, though it maintains that activity overall remains “low” nationwide.

The probability that the epidemic is growing is highest in California, Texas, Louisiana, Mississippi, Alabama, Florida, Kentucky and Ohio, among others.
(snip)

The uptick is part of a predicted summer spike, which lasts from July to September as part of a twice-a-year pattern recently identified by the CDC. The second spike comes in winter, typically from December to February.
